Archival Overview

Indian sitar virtuoso of the Imdadkhani gharana who modified the structure of the sitar to develop the revolutionary 'gayaki ang' (vocal style), making the instrument sing with the human voice.

Biographical Record

Born into six generations of master musicians, Ustad Vilayat Khan (1928–2004) was a child prodigy who recorded his first 78 rpm disc at eight years old. Dissatisfied with the mechanical plucked sound of the sitar, he physically redesigned it: removing low bass strings, adding steel plates, and tuning sympathetic strings to mimic the nuances of classical khyal singing.

His fiery, lyrical duels with master tabla players like Kishen Maharaj became legendary. Fiercely independent and aristocratic in temperament, he famously refused national honors like the Padma Shri and Padma Bhushan, arguing the awarding committee lacked musical qualification to judge him.

Key Life Milestones

1950

Invention of the Gayaki Ang on Sitar

Pioneered the vocal singing technique on sitar, transforming 20th-century instrumental performance.

1958

Film Score for Satyajit Ray's 'Jalsaghar'

Composed the celebrated classical soundtrack for Satyajit Ray's masterpiece 'The Music Room'.
